Housing costs continue to rise in Milwaukee, driven by strong buyer demand and a shortage of available listings. Recent data indicates that prospective homebuyers in the area can expect to pay significantly higher monthly mortgage payments compared to previous years. The competitive market has led to bidding wars, pushing prices upward as buyers scramble to secure homes.
As interest rates fluctuate, the financial landscape for homebuyers becomes increasingly complex. Many are finding it necessary to adjust their budgets to accommodate the rising costs. The average monthly mortgage payment has surged, reflecting both the increased home prices and the impact of interest rates on borrowing costs.
Real estate experts suggest that potential buyers should conduct thorough research and consider their long-term financial goals before making a purchase. With the current market dynamics, it is essential for homebuyers to be prepared for the challenges ahead in securing their dream home in Milwaukee.
